Why Thermal Management is Critical for Energy Storage Batteries
Energy storage systems are the backbone of renewable energy grids, electric vehicles, and industrial power solutions. However, battery thermal management products play a pivotal role in ensuring these systems operate safely and efficiently. Without proper temperature control, batteries can overheat, degrade faster, or even fail catastrophically. Let's break down why this technology matters and how it's shaping industries globally.
The Science Behind Battery Thermal Runaway
Imagine a lithium-ion battery as a tightly packed orchestra—each component must harmonize. When temperatures rise uncontrollably (a phenomenon called thermal runaway), the entire system risks collapse. Thermal management solutions act like a conductor, maintaining balance through:
- Active cooling systems (liquid or air-based)
- Passive insulation materials
- Advanced phase-change materials (PCMs)
Applications Across Industries
From solar farms to electric trucks, thermal management is non-negotiable. Here's where these products shine:
1. Renewable Energy Storage
Solar and wind energy systems rely on batteries to store excess power. But fluctuating temperatures? That's a problem. For example, a 2023 study by Grand View Research revealed that thermal management solutions can extend battery lifespan by up to 35% in solar applications.
2. Electric Vehicles (EVs)
Did you know EVs lose up to 20% of their range in extreme cold? Advanced thermal systems mitigate this by:
- Preheating batteries in winter
- Cooling them during fast charging
Tesla's Model S, for instance, uses a liquid cooling system to maintain optimal temperatures, boosting both safety and performance.
3. Industrial Backup Power
Factories can't afford downtime. Thermal-regulated batteries ensure uninterrupted power during outages. A 2022 case study showed that a German manufacturing plant reduced energy waste by 18% after upgrading its thermal management systems.

Innovations Driving the Industry Forward
What's next for battery thermal management? Here are three breakthroughs to watch:
- AI-Powered Predictive Systems: Algorithms that anticipate temperature spikes before they occur.
- Graphene-Based Cooling: Materials that dissipate heat 50% faster than traditional copper.
- Modular Designs: Scalable solutions for custom applications, from small homes to utility-scale projects.
